  • The Science of Strawberry Flavor: Why They're So Delicious
    There are several reasons why strawberries taste so good. Here are a few:

    1. Sugar content: Strawberries have a high sugar content, which gives them their sweet flavor. The average strawberry contains about 7 grams of sugar.

    2. Acidity: Strawberries also have a high acidity level, which helps to balance out the sweetness and create a more complex flavor. The main acids in strawberries are malic acid and citric acid.

    3. Aromas: Strawberries produce a variety of aromas that contribute to their flavor. These aromas include esters, aldehydes, and ketones. Some of the key aromas in strawberries include ethyl butyrate, methyl anthranilate, and furaneol.

    4. Texture: Strawberries have a tender,juicy texture that adds to their appeal. The texture of strawberries is due to their high water content and the presence of pectin, a type of fiber.

    5. Freshness: Strawberries are best eaten fresh when they have the highest levels of sugar, acidity, and aromas. Strawberries that are not fresh will start to lose their flavor and texture.

    When all of these factors come together, the result is a delicious and refreshing fruit that is enjoyed by people all over the world.
